Chapter 17

“You make a mean sandwich,” Wylie said after taking a bite.

“Practice. Lots of practice. When it comes to feeding myself when I’m not at work, I take the easy way out.”

Wylie nodded, as his mouth was full. He hadn’t realized he was hungry until he started eating. When he finished the last bite he sighed with contentment. “I needed that.”

“Knew you would,” Garry replied. “Now, where were you before I interrupted?”

“Getting ready to cut that section into pieces.” Wylie pointed to where he’d stopped.

“Okay, you do that; I’ll deal with the padding. Do you have another mask?”

“Yep, hang on.” Wylie got one for him and they set to work. With Garry’s help, and the trash bags he took time to get from home, the room was down to the bare floor by evening. All that remained was to remove the tack strip, which Wylie said he’d do in the morning before taking everything to the dump. “Right now we need to shower and change into clean clothes. Then I’m taking you out to dinner.”
